Ascot Hotel Dubai
Khalid Bin Walid Road Bur Dubai |
Whether you are in Dubai for business or pleasure, the Ascot Hotel offers a good choice of accommodation, facilities as well as service and best value for your money.
Location
Situated in the centre of Bur Dubai and built in graceful Georgian style, the Ascot Hotel redefines conventional standards of luxury and hospitality. Minutes away from the Dubai World Trade Centre, major shopping areas and malls, the hotel is approximately 9 kilometres away from Dubai International Airport.
Rooms
Luxuriate in a world of elegance and charm, Ascot Hotel offers exclusive and tastefully decorated rooms. All of them are centrally air-conditioned with individual temperature control and have well equipped en suite bathrooms.
Restaurant
The hotel also boasts a remarkable wine-bar and lounge, an Irish pub and cuisine, as varied as Lebanese, Italian, Russian and Japanese.
General
For private meetings and conferences, the hotel offers a conference room that seats up to 30 people. A full range of presentation aids, including slide projector, flip charts and video recorders are available. At leisure, you can avail the massage services offered by the hotel or relax at the steam room.
